Voter resource campaign, website announced for 2024 election

Posted

CHEYENNE — For the 2024 election cycle, the Wyoming Secretary of State’s Office is announcing its comprehensive voter information campaign designed to provide the public with the resources and information they need for the 2024 election. The campaign’s “Wyoming Votes” webpage contains information related to voter registration, polling locations, Voter ID requirements, reporting a concern, and changes to Wyoming’s absentee voting statutes. The webpage is part of a multimedia effort to inform Wyoming voters ahead of the primary and general elections.

“At the Secretary of State’s Office, we are very excited about administering the 2024 Election Cycle,” Secretary of State Chuck Gray said. “I want to commend our Elections Division for spearheading this Campaign, which provides a number of resources to inform Wyoming’s citizens exercising their right to vote. Should Wyomingites have any questions or concerns, I urge them to contact our office. At the Secretary of State’s Office, we remain focused on serving the people of Wyoming and conducting a great election.”

The Campaign’s “Wyoming Votes” webpage can be found at letsvotewyo.org.
